It seems like your house is always warmer at night than it was during the day. You crank the thermostat further, but the temperature just won't drop. There are a few reasons why this happens. One factor is that your house has had all day to accumulate heat from the sun. The walls, floors, and even the furniture will have stored some of that heat. At night, when the sun isn't shining anymore, this stored heat starts to radiate back into your house, making it feel warmer.
Another reason is insulation. If your house doesn't have good barrier, heat can easily leaked out during the day and infiltrate back in at night. Finally, your air conditioning system may be cycling on more frequently at night because it's trying to compensate for the extra heat in the house.
- Make sure your windows and doors are properly sealed to prevent heat from entering or escaping.
- Implement heavy curtains or blinds to block out the sun's rays during the day.
- Check your insulation levels and add more if necessary.
- Invest in a programmable thermostat to help you control the temperature at night.

How Your House Gets Warmer After Dark
As the sun dips below the horizon, a curious thing often happens. Your house may seemingly warmer, even though it's getting dark outside. This shift in temperature isn't just a trick of your perception; there are some scientific factors at play.
One key factor is heat absorption. During the day, your roof and walls absorb large amounts of solar energy. As the sun goes down, this trapped heat gradually radiates back into your home.
Another factor is the lack of sunlight's warming effect. During the day, sunlight helps raise the temperature of both your home and the surrounding air. At night, with , this warming influence stops.
Finally, consider your home's insulation. Adequately insulated homes trap heat more effectively, leading to a more noticeable temperature difference between day and night.
